The 1983-formed Megadeth ranks among the greatest thrash metal bands, along with Metallica, Slayer, and Anthrax. Their 1986 album “Peace Sells… But Who’s Buying,” is still relevant. With its intricate guitar work, ferocious riffs, and thought-provoking lyrics, the album established Megadeth as a heavy metal classic and showcased Dave Mustaine’s creative vision.
Many admire “Peace Sells… But Who’s Buying” for its political commentary on corruption, bloodshed, and greed. The title single’s catchy bassline and biting satire protest the public’s indifference to social issues. Band riffs and solos on the CD show their technical skill. “Wake Up Dead” and “Devil’s Island,” with their fierce sound and sophisticated song structures, help cement the album’s thrash metal prominence.

To understand “Peace Sells… But Who’s Buying,” one must first detect its resemblance to classic metal albums. Metallica’s elaborate orchestration of “Master of Puppets,” released the same decade, addresses control and addiction. Slayer’s “Reign in Blood” explores gloomy themes and brutal music. Megadeth, like many bands of the same age, experimented with new sounds and lyrics, delighting both those who wanted deeper topics and those who wanted catchier songs.

Additionally, Megadeth’s heavy metal contributions have inspired numerous artists and musicians from many genres. Other bands including Trivium, Lamb of God, and Arch Enemy cite Megadeth as a major influence. These bands’ technical aspects and nuanced musicianship resemble Megadeth’s mid-1980s and later output. This legacy has inspired generations of musicians to broaden metal’s boundaries while honouring the pioneers.
